首页> 外文会议>2010 IEEE International Symposium on Parallel amp; Distributed Processing (IPDPS) >Load regulating algorithm for static-priority task scheduling on multiprocessors
【24h】

Load regulating algorithm for static-priority task scheduling on multiprocessors

机译:多处理器静态优先级任务调度的负载调节算法

获取原文
获取原文并翻译 | 示例

摘要

This paper proposes a fixed-priority partitioned scheduling algorithm for periodic tasks on multiprocessors. A new technique for assigning tasks to processors is developed and the schedulability of the algorithm is analyzed for worst-case performance. We prove that, if the workload (utilization) of a given task set is less than or equal to 55.2% of the total processing capacity on m processors, then all tasks meet their deadlines. During task assignment, the total work load is regulated to the processors in such a way that a subset of the processors are guaranteed to have an individual processor load of at least 55.2%. Due to such load regulation, our algorithm can be used efficiently as an admission controller for online task scheduling. And this online algorithm is scalable with increasing number of cores in chip multiprocessors. In addition, our scheduling algorithm possesses two properties that may be important for the system designer. The first one guarantees that if task priorities are fixed before task assignment they do not change during task assignment and execution, thereby facilitating debugging during development and maintenance of the system. The second property guarantees that at most m/2 tasks are split, thereby keeping the run-time overhead as caused by task splitting low.
机译:针对多处理器上的周期性任务,本文提出了一种固定优先级的分区调度算法。开发了一种将任务分配给处理器的新技术,并对算法的可调度性进行了分析,以获取最坏情况的性能。我们证明,如果给定任务集的工作负载(利用率)小于或等于m个处理器上总处理能力的55.2%,则所有任务都将按时完成。在任务分配期间,以保证处理器的一个子集具有至少55.2%的单独处理器负载的方式来调节处理器的总工作负载。由于这种负载调节,我们的算法可以有效地用作在线任务调度的准入控制器。而且这种在线算法可以随着芯片多处理器中内核数量的增加而扩展。另外,我们的调度算法具有两个属性,这可能对系统设计者很重要。第一个保证如果任务优先级在任务分配之前是固定的,则它们在任务分配和执行期间不会改变,从而有助于在系统开发和维护期间进行调试。第二个属性保证最多拆分m / 2个任务,从而使由任务拆分引起的运行时开销保持较低。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号